Oxidation number of carbon in carbon suboxide `(C_(3)O_(2))` is :

A

`+ 2//3`

B

`+ 4//3`

C

`+4`

D

`- 4//3`

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
B

Let O.N of C in `C_(3)O_(2)` is x
`:. 3x + 2(-2) = 0 or x = 4//3`.
